4. Music.
a.
the adult male voice intermediate between the bass and the alto or countertenor.
b.
a part sung by or written for such a voice, especially the next to the lowest part in four-part harmony.
c.
a singer with such a voice.
d.
an instrument corresponding in compass to this voice, especially the viola.
e.
the lowest-toned bell of a peal.
1. music
a. the male voice intermediate between alto and baritone, having a range approximately from the B a ninth below middle C to the G a fifth above it
b. a singer with such a voice
c. a saxophone, horn, recorder, etc, intermediate in compass and size between the alto and baritone or bass
d. ( as modifier ): a tenor sax
